A certain test is worth 145 points. How many points (rounded to the nearest point) are needed to obtain a score of 75%?

Answer:

109

Step-by-step explanation:

The point score is obtained by multiplying the total score with the percentage i.e.

[tex]75\%\times145=108.75\approx109[/tex] to the nearest point.
